The Abstract paragraph should not be indented. Exceptions: Entries on the References page should have a hanging indent 0.5" to the left.Each paragraph should be indented 0.5" to the right.Each should begin on a separate page with a bold, centered heading. The paper should be broken into a Title page, Abstract (if applicable), main paper, and References page.Each sentence should have a single space between it and the next sentence.The paper should be double-spaced, with no extra spaces in between sections.Headings and section titles (Abstracts, References, etc.) should appear centered and bolded, without any extra spaces or line breaks.The page number should appear in the top right page header on each page.Use a size 11-12 pt readable font, such as Calibri, Arial, or Times New Roman.Margins should be 1" on each side of the page.
